    ( A ) Schematic of XL-MS workflow. ( B ) XL-based interactome of synaptic ribosomes. Synaptic annotation is based on SynGO (dataset version 20231201). ( C ) Protein domain-level crosslink map between RPL35 and CaMKIIα. Domain classification based on . ( D ) Structural model of CaMKIIα binding to the ribosome. Most CaMKIIα–RPL35 crosslinks satisfy distance constraints (green), with remaining links accommodated by CaMKIIα linker flexibility (yellow). ( E ) Detection of newly-synthesized proteins in dendrites and synapses from control (untreated) neurons or neurons treated with 10 μM KN-93 or myr-AIP for 30 min. Nascent proteins were labeled with puromycin (5 min) in the absence or presence of the protein synthesis inhibitor anisomycin (see Methods). Scale bar, 5 µm. ( F ) Quantification of puromycin signal in postsynaptic regions of the apical dendritic arbor from control and treated neurons. Error bars show mean ± SEM. **p<0.01; ****p<0.0001, Brown-Forsythe and Welch’s ANOVA, Dunnett’s multiple comparisons test; n=58-64 neurons from 3 independent cultures.

    CaMKII is partially required for SMC necroptosis. ( A – D ) MOVAS cells were pretreated with indicated doses of CaMKII inhibitor myristoylated autocamtide-2-related inhibitory peptide (Myr-AIP) for 1 h, followed by 6 h of treatment with 30 ng/mL TNFα plus 60 µM zVAD. ( A ) Cells were lysed in RIPA buffer and subjected to Western blotting analysis with the indicated antibodies. ( C ) Cells were stained with 7-AAD and Annexin V, and subjected to flow cytometry analysis. Necrotic cells were identified as 7-AAD + Annexin V + . ( B ) was quantification of ( A ). ( D ) was quantification of ( C ). ( E ) MOVAS cells were transfected with siRNAs against Camk2d for 48 h. Cells were lysed in RIPA buffer and subjected to Western blotting analysis with the indicated antibodies. ( F , G ) Quantification of ( E ). ( H ) MOVAS cells were transfected with siRNAs against Camk2d for 48 h, then treated with 30 ng/mL TNFα plus 60 µM zVAD for 6 h. Cells were then stained with 7-AAD and Annexin V, and subjected to flow cytometry analysis. Necrotic cells were identified as 7-AAD + Annexin V + . ( I ) Quantification of ( H ). Data were presented as mean ± SD of at least three independent experiments. One-way ANOVA was performed in ( B , D , F , G , I ). * p < 0.05, ** p < 0.01, *** p < 0.001 compared with TNFα plus zVAD treated group ( B , D , I ) or scrambled siRNA-treated group ( F , G ).
